those least responsible for the climate crisis are being hit first, hardest, and are least able to 'cope'. Hundreds of millions are suffering from climate change-related impacts around the world. Hundreds of thousands die each year. 4 billion are vulnerable NOW. This summer (2010):
- Africa -- Severe drought. 10 million hungry or starving. Unknown deaths and suffering. Epic humanitarian crisis.
- Pakistan -- Massive floods. Record heat. 1/5th of country/160,000 square miles under water. 20 million+ affected. 1,600+ deaths. 20 million homeless. Epic humanitarian crisis.
- India -- Record heat. Flash floods. At least hundreds dead.
- N. Korea -- Massive floods. Tens of thousands of acres of farmland submerged. Unknown deaths.
- Latin America -- Floods, mudslides, downpours. At least hundreds dead.
- China -- Major mudslide. 150 million affected. 1,100+ deaths. 12 million previously suffered months-long drought, now displaced by mass-flooding. Tens of billions damage.
- Russia -- 1,000-year record heat wave. Intense smog from hundreds of wildfires. Tens of millions affected. Triple death rate -- Thousands dead, 300 people a day. Millions of hectares of wheat crops (1/3) compromised. Grain exports banned. Billions damage. Prices up globally. Radiation threat.
